Fine this is where I stand.

I really think that Jim and Pam are going to date and help eachother become who they need to be for other people. I really think that GD is going to go down the path where the last scene is Jim and Pam being friends but going separate ways knowing that they will always be important to one another.

I also think that if Jim and Pam are not friends and do not build there friendship back up this season then JAM will fail. Jim is to fragile to handle anything but baby steps, and that means that he needs to focus on himself. He just made a big life choice he is not going to be making any more anytime soon.

Now, I think that if they did get engaged.. which agian I do not see GD ever doing that, at least for this season it is not right for Jim or Pam. if they do get engaged we will not see the proposal, nor will we see the wedding that is way to sitcom and The Office does not do that.

Also I do not know if Jim and Pam will actually be together next season it is just one date.. only one date.

Now all that said.. what I think will happen in the office and what happens in my mind are two different things.

but all I know is that I would like Jim and Pam to date, but right now neither Jim, Pam, nor the office is ready for an engagement anytime soon.. if there is one then I have to say that they will have jumped the shark.
